Woolworths launches 70 new items – and the cheapest is $3

Woolworths has unveiled its largest new food launch since Christmas with 70 items being added just in time for winter.

The launch adds more than 70 new items to the Woolworths COOK range, including roasts, meal kits, and options for vegans and vegetarians.

The meals celebrate Australian-made ingredients and meat and also have RSPCA-approved chicken.

"Woolworths is introducing more than 70 convenient new fresh meal solutions, ideal for mid-week dinners or entertaining, to help customers save time on winter-warming dishes over the cooler months," Woolworths said in a statement.

The new items launched on Wednesday and are available at Woolworths supermarkets or online. Prices range from $3 to $28.

Customers can enjoy quick and easy oven cooked roasts, such as Boneless Rolled Chicken Roast with Lemon, Garlic, Thyme and Sourdough stuffing and Beef Rump Mini Roast with Mustard and Herb.

While the COOK range is also taking inspiration from international cuisine, providing meal kits for under $10, like Butter Chicken Curry and Vietnamese Yellow Pork Curry, and vegetarian and vegan options like Plant-Based Jackfruit Chilli and Plant-Based Chickpea Tagine.

Woolworths has also added to its range of crumbed chicken and Meze-style and entertaining spreads like Mushroom Arancini, Zucchini Fritters and Beef Kofta using 100 per cent Australian beef mince.

Woolworths introduces new range of Strength Meals

Woolworths is also introducing the exclusive range of Strength Meals Co products in the Fresh Ready Meals and Soups department.

"This high-protein range makes healthier and fresh options more convenient for customers who lead active and fast paced lifestyles," Woolworths said in a press release.

Woolworths Director of Buying Paul Harker said customer's feedback was kept in mind when creating the new range.

"We’ve put customer feedback at the heart of our new winter range, with customers telling us they’re looking for convenient and affordable options," he said.

“But they’re also looking for larger portion sizes, so we’ve increased the size of several lines like our stir-fry and introduced hearty dishes for roasting, offering better value for families or for entertaining."
